Spiced Eggplant Soup, Coconut & Coriander — Interactive video experience

A rich, aromatic soup combining golden-fried eggplant with a fragrant base of ginger, garlic, green curry paste, and warm spices. Infused with lemongrass, kaffir lime, and finished with creamy coconut and fresh coriander, this comforting dish is perfect for a quick and satisfying meal. Brightened with a splash of lime juice, it serves six and comes together in under an hour.

Method

  1. Prepare Eggplant — Heat a large heavy-based frypan over medium-high heat.Fry eggplant in batches with a generous amount of vegetable oil until soft and golden.Season with salt and pepper. Set aside.
  2. Prepare Coriander — Wash and drain the coriander well.Remove roots and finely chop them (yes, you can use the Braun chopper for this).Finely chop the stalks and leaves separately and set aside for garnish.
  3. Make the Soup Base — In a medium pot, heat 4 tbsp of vegetable oil over medium heat.Sauté onion, ginger, and garlic for about 4 minutes until soft and translucent
  4. Build the Flavour — Stir in ground coriander, cumin, turmeric, and Ayam curry paste. Cook for 1 minute.Add coriander roots, lemongrass, green chilli, and kaffir lime leaves.Cook for a further 2–3 minutes until aromatic.
  5. Simmer — Pour in the stock and Ayam coconut cream. Bring to a gentle simmer.
  6. Finish the Curry — Just before serving, stir in the cooked eggplant. Bring back to a simmer.Finish with lime juice and top with chopped coriander stalks and leaves.
